Contents:
1. Command, market and mixed economies -- 2. The transition economies -- 3. Microeconomics and macroeconomics -- 4. Unemployment and inflation -- 5. Free trade, regional agreements and strategic policies -- 6. Customs unions and common markets -- 7. Money, banking and international finance -- 8. Exchange rates and currency union -- 9. The economics of oil -- 10. Foreign debt, financial crises and international policemen -- 11. Development, growth and Asian dragons -- 12. Environmental economics: sustaining spaceship earth -- Conclusion: into the twenty-first century.
Summary: This edition has been updated to take account of current developments in this area of economics. Building on the first edition, the overall structure is retained whilst new topic boxes and up-to-date examples add to its accessibility.
